A novel e-cadherin/sox9 axis regulates cancer stem cells in multiple myeloma by activating akt and mapk pathways

HIGHLIGHTS

  • who: Parinya Samart from the (UNIVERSITY) have published the Article: A novel E-cadherin/SOX9 axis regulates cancer stem cells in multiple myeloma by activating Akt and MAPK pathways, in the Journal: (JOURNAL)
  • what: The authors show that depletion of E-cadherin in MM cells remarkably inhibited cell proliferation and cell cycle progression in part through the decreased prosurvival CD138 and Bcl-2 and the inactivated Akt and CSC features including the ability of the cells to form clonogenic colonies indicative of self-renewal and side population were greatly suppressed upon the depletion of E . . .
